NORDUnet A/S
NORDUnet A/S is a non-profit company for Nordic research network collaboration between Denmark, Finland, Iceland, Sweden and Norway. NORDUnet links the Nordic research networks together and connects them to international research networks in Europe, the USA and the rest of the world.
NORDUnet was established in 1989 as a collaboration project, originating in the NORDUNET programme under the Nordic Council of Ministers. The organization was founded as a limited liability company in 1993.
SUNET

SUNET stands for Swedish University Computer Network. It is a joint organization for the universities, which, without being its own juridical person, works towards the goal that University Sweden will always have access to a computer network that maintains a very good quality.
Todays university computer network is called GigaSunet and this provides Universities in Sweden with a capacity of 10 Gbit/sec. Swedish universities and university colleges have access to one of the world's best academic computer networks.
Chalmers University of Technology
Chalmers was founded in 1829 as the result of a donation from the Director of the Swedish East India Company, William Chalmers. His forwardly optimistic motto, which remains ours today, is: "Avancez!"
Chalmers University of Technology is a multifaceted academic and postgraduate university that conducts research and education across a wide front within the areas of technology, natural science and architecture.
